# Revised Commission Scheme — Managers Only

Effective next quarter. Base commission drops to 4%; accelerator kicks in at 110% of target, capped at 9%. Multi-year Fenwick Suite deals count at 1.5x. Clawbacks apply to cancellations within 90 days. Renewal book excluded unless expanded 20%+. Draws end after month three for new hires. Questions go to regional leads, not HR. Context on why we moved now follows below.

board note of yadup-fajef: Druiusox Holdings is in early talks to buy Norwynek Systems for about $186.0 million. The Kaseth launch date is June 24, and nothing goes to the press before then. Legal wants the Quenethek Group term sheet withdrawn before November 27.

Subject: EXIF scrubbing cut-over — summary for review

Hi,

As of last night, all image uploads to Pictaro route through the new Scrubmill pipeline, which strips EXIF metadata (GPS, device serials, timestamps) before objects reach durable storage. The legacy in-process scrubber is disabled but still deployed for one more sprint as a fallback. We replayed 48 hours of uploads through both paths and diffed outputs — zero discrepancies. Please review the pipeline code alongside the active configuration values, which follow.

deployment values, yahag-tawef:
ZORWYN_HOST=zorwyn.tolvaqlabs.internal
ZORWYN_PORT=9300

## Configuration

The `tailglass` CLI reads its settings from `~/.tailglass/env` at startup. Region, buffer size, and redaction mode are all plain-text options documented in `CONFIG.md`. Access to the Fennwick log broker is authenticated per-user, and the broker credential must be set on the line immediately following this sentence.

vault entry, yahif-yajep: COURIER_KEY29=b802bdf8034096b65a51c6ba5abe2

## Support

Timegrid Solver handles constraint-based timetable generation for the Ashfell school district pilot. If the solver fails to converge, first check the constraints file for contradictory room assignments — that covers most reported issues. Logs land in the `solver-runs` directory with one folder per attempt. Known limitations are tracked in the backlog board; check there before filing anything new. For solver bugs or constraint-model questions, reach the maintainers directly.

pager mailbox: druwyn@norvaio.corp